What Aussie Players Need To Watch Out For Before Jumping In

That said, it’s not all free wins and easy rides. There are a few classic pitfalls that Aussie players tend to run into when chasing no deposit bonuses at Rich casinos:

  • Wagering Requirements: These often sit between 30x to 75x, which means winnings from free spins can be tricky to cash out without meeting hefty playthrough demands.
  • Max Cashout Limits: Casinos typically cap maximum withdrawals from no deposit bonuses—don’t expect to walk away with a jackpot-sized payout on a freebie spin.
  • Game Restrictions: Most freebies lock you into specific pokies, often from Betsoft or IGT, so your free spins won’t work on every game.
  • No Consecutive Bonuses: Many Rich family sites enforce a “one bonus at a time” rule. Grab a no deposit freebie first, then you might have to deposit before claiming another free reward.
  • License & Jurisdiction: While Curacao licenses are common in this group, some offers blur lines about their terms for Aussie players—always check the fine print to avoid surprises.

Getting your head around these key points can save you from walking into bonus traps that feel like a bait and switch. Better still, you’ll be ready to scoop up freebies and spin smarter, turning those no deposit bonuses into genuine cashouts instead of stuck credits.

Decoding Terms and Conditions: What You Don’t Want to Miss

Pink flags in bonus T&Cs that can drain your bankroll fast

Terms that seem straightforward can hide traps. One red flag is a no-consecutive bonus rule that kills successive free spin claims without deposits. Another is deceptive wagering: sometimes 45x wager looks reasonable, but when combined with max cashout caps, it shrinks your real gains. Freebie-only winnings often can’t be withdrawn until hefty turnovers are cleared.

The no-consecutive bonus trap, wagering sneaks, and withdrawal limits with examples

For instance, grab $150 free spins as a Silver VIP, but if you skip depositing, your next $250 Golden VIP bonus becomes void. Wagering of 45x the bonus plus deposit means a $150 bonus requires $6,750 in bets before you touch withdrawal. Meanwhile, a max cashout of $600 means any winnings beyond that are forfeited despite wagering. These financial grabs can empty your free bank faster than you realise.

Quick checklist to screen bonuses like a pro

  • Check wagering requirements and how they combine with deposits
  • Spot max withdrawal limits on free spins or bonus winnings
  • Confirm game restrictions (only pokies? Betsoft/IGT only?)
  • Understand time expiry on bonuses (usually under 7 days)
  • Look for “no consecutive bonus” rules before stacking offers

Keeping these points in mind helps lock in genuine profits and steers clear of nasty surprises that drain your bankroll quicker than a busted spin.
